Working with the total joint team, I specialize in concerns related to the hip and knee. Communication and patient education surrounding one’s disease state and treatment options guide my orthopaedic practice. I collaborate with my patients to understand their concerns and goals for care and can then establish a treatment plan catered to their unique issue. My goal is to exhaust all available conservative and surgical treatment options in pursuit of pain relief that enables my patients to improve their daily function and get back to what they enjoy.

About
Rachel has a Bachelor’s of Science in Psychology from the University of Wisconsin Whitewater and a Bachelor’s of Science in Nursing from the University of Wisconsin Milwaukee. She received her Masters of Science in Nursing from Marquette University, where she also received her post Masters in Acute Care Nurse Practitioner. Rachel has served as Adjunct Nursing Faculty at Moraine Park Technical College and Marquette University. She has been working with Orthopaedic patients in a variety of roles since 2007. In her free time, she enjoys spending time outdoors, hiking and camping.
